Bleeding in the short term

Women may experience a small amount of bleeding for a short period of time after having an IUD inserted. This phenomenon is mainly caused by the fact that the placement of the contraceptive ring may scratch the endometrium, thereby causing bleeding. However, this situation can be repaired quickly. The bleeding usually lasts for several days, and the amount of blood does not exceed the menstrual volume, so no treatment is required.

Causes ectopic pregnancy

The purpose of IUD insertion is to prevent pregnancy and childbirth, but the contraceptive effect of IUD insertion can only prevent normal pregnancy in the uterus, but it has no effect on preventing ectopic pregnancy and cannot avoid it. If the embryo implants in the fallopian tube and does not reach the uterus, it will cause an ectopic pregnancy.
